Output 8e2bcb26dffe3cdd91c1921985df1a67d734326d3e19150237d2151f43f4b301:1

value
620782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3919fd8c47140d22ae3459650413756e84cff2aa OP_EQUAL
address
36twaKm2Bh3ZXd2eSaoxLiCK1s91zhacSz
transaction
8e2bcb26dffe3cdd91c1921985df1a67d734326d3e19150237d2151f43f4b301